Cafe Espresso Machines
Unlike coffee pots, cafe espresso machines can make many different caffeinated beverages. They also have a wide variety of features that allow users to precisely control the brewing variables.
The machine is pre-programmed with settings for the most popular classic drinks. Advanced baristas are able to customize these settings to suit their personal preferences. Before buying a machine it is important to understand your own requirements and expectations.
Easy to use
A cafe espresso machine makes espresso by pumping pressurized water through finely ground coffee beans. The tiny coffee maker is a technological marvel. It is comprised of a reservoir that has an handle and a group head (or "basket") that attaches to the portafilter. The portafilter, which is a tiny filter for grounds, is to be tamped before putting it in the gasket. This ensures proper pressure and flavor extraction. The espresso machine also has a steam arm and nozzle to heat the milk to make drinks like cappuccino and latte.
The controls of an espresso machine are simple to read and easy. The on/off switch and indicators indicate whether the heating chamber has reached a hot or cold temperature. The control valve is used to initiate the flow of water through the portafilter when the brew button is activated. It also serves to control the flow of steam through the wand. espresso machine with frother Coffeee and brew button can be programmed to meet an individual taste.
The majority of espresso machines are rated to produce up to 20 bar of pressure. This can allow the machine produce an excellent shot, however it is crucial to remember that higher pressure doesn't always mean better. Over-pressurizing the machine can cause bitterness and over-extraction.
A high-quality espresso machine should be able to produce an adequate shot despite unbalanced grounds or poorly made portafilters. A great espresso should have a thick creamy crema that is able to stick to the cup. It should also have a clean sweet, sweet taste and a pleasant scent.
A basic espresso machine is a good option for home use however more sophisticated machines are a great investment for coffee shops and businesses. Many cafes have a wide variety of high-end equipment. The top ones come with features like multi-boilers and advanced PID control, and pre-infusion.
These machines might be more expensive, however they will create a drink that is more consistent than the cheaper machines. They are also easier to use and allow you to make a wider variety of specialty drinks. In addition, they will provide a more satisfying experience than pod-based machines.
Easy to clean
An espresso machine is an important investment that delivers energy-boosting shots of coffee to your customers. It also boosts your business by elevating the experience of drinking coffee, and is a great method to increase revenue per ticket. Like all other pieces of equipment, it requires proper cleaning and care. This will help keep your coffee fresh and delicious, and extend its lifespan.
Espresso machines have a variety of cleaning products, including specialized descaling solutions. Before using them products, make sure you check the instructions of the manufacturer. If you use the wrong product, it could damage the espresso machine, or create unpleasant flavors in your drinks.
It is important to clean your cafe espresso machine daily. Professional baristas will usually do this every day at the end of the day's activities However, you can also include it in your regular housekeeping. First, wash the portafilters and group head with hot water. If you notice stains then use a brush to remove them. Also, clean the steam arm, water screen and portafilter holder with a soft cloth. If your espresso machine has drip tray, you should clean it every day also.
Backflushing the espresso machine is a further important step. This can be done by washing and brushing under the group head. This is to get rid of the dregs left over after brewing. If your espresso machine does not come with backflush function it is still possible to do it manually.
Backflushing your espresso machine at least once per month or once a week is recommended. If you do not, a layer may accumulate over the ports and other components. This can alter the taste and smell of your coffee. Clean machines will create the best Crema which is a thin layer of bubbles that are placed on the top of your espresso.
Easy to maintain
The success of a specialty coffee shop is contingent on two things: staff and equipment. When either one fails, it could leave the coffee shop in hot water- literally. You should consider scheduling a routine maintenance with a reputable repair and maintenance firm to avoid this. This will save you costly downtime and make sure your espresso machine is in good condition for the morning rush.
It's not easy to schedule routine maintenance, but it's better than dealing with a major failure of equipment during the morning rush. And it will allow you to keep your customers content and coming back for more of the delicious drinks that you're known for.
The maintenance schedule for a coffee machine should include regular cleaning of the removable parts, and weekly refilling of the water reservoir. This will reduce the risk of water residue accumulation and mineral deposits. The type of water that is used in the machine can affect the frequency and intensity at the amount of mineral deposits that build up. Hard water can cause mineral deposits to accumulate faster, while soft or filtered water is less demanding for the machine.
It is essential to check the temperature and pressure of water regularly, and cleaning the shower each day. This are affected by a variety of factors, including the quality of the water and the pressure of the steam wand. If the water pressure is low, it's vital to increase it to the recommended levels set by the manufacturer.
The group head is another important part of an espresso machine, and it needs to be cleaned frequently. It is the main route for water to flow through the machine and directly affects the taste of coffee brewed. Keep the head of the group clean to avoid it developing a bitter taste.
